Waterfront South, Camden, NJ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Waterfront South?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Waterfront South Studio Apartments | $1,676 | $950 | $2,538 |
| Waterfront South 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,049 | $797 | $4,221 |
| Waterfront South 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,838 | $1,124 | $8,477 |
| Waterfront South 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,676 | $1,318 | $10,000+ |
| Waterfront South 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,570 | $1,404 | $1,737 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Waterfront South Apartments with Laundry Rooms
What is the Cheapest Laundry Rooms apartment in Waterfront South?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Waterfront South with Laundry Rooms is at Tamarack Station Apartments listed at $797.
How much is the average rent for Waterfront South Apartments with Laundry Rooms?
The average rent for a Apartment in Waterfront South with Laundry Rooms is $2,409.
What is the largest Waterfront South Apartment for rent with Laundry Rooms?
Today's Apartment with Laundry Rooms and the most square footage in Waterfront South is a 3,053 square feet unit starting from $2,085 at The Broderick.
What is the average size for Waterfront South Apartments for rent with Laundry Rooms?
The average size for a rental with Laundry Rooms in Waterfront South is currently at 602 sq ft.
